  • Bengals' Amarius Mims: Returns to action

    Mims (shin) has returned to Sunday's game against the Cardinals, Charlie Goldsmith of the Dayton Daily News reports. Mims was evaluated by medical staff, and his shin injury was determined to be harmless enough to play through. The right tackle has reclaimed his position on the offensive line from Cody Ford.

  • Bengals' Amarius Mims: Full practice Wednesday

    Mims (knee) was a full participant at practice Wednesday, Paul Dehner Jr. of The Athletic reports. Mims was forced to exit the team's Week 15 loss to the Ravens early with a knee injury, but he now appears to be all set to play Sunday versus the Dolphins. The 23-year-old will be back in his starting role at right tackle against Miami.

  • Bengals' Amarius Mims: Played with broken hand

    Mims played through a broken right hand towards the end of the 2024 season, Charlie Goldsmith reports. Mims played in limited snaps towards the end of the 2024 season and was dealing with a banged-up ankle in addition to his broken hand. He'll be counted on to take the next step up after having mixed results in his rookie season.

  • Bengals' Amarius Mims: Leaves with ankle injury

    Mims left Sunday's Week 5 game against the Ravens with an ankle injury, Fox's Melanie Collins reported on the game broadcast. Cody Ford replaced him at right tackle. Mims is questionable to return. The Bengals are already down Trent Brown for the season at right tackle, but Mims had thrived since entering the lineup. Mims previously had tightrope surgery on that ankle in college.

  • Bengals' Amarius Mims: Back on the field

    Mims (pectoral) returned to practice Monday, Kelsey Conway of The Cincinnati Enquirer reports. Mims strained his pectoral muscle in the Bengals' preseason game against the Buccaneers on Aug. 10, and he was expected to miss multiple weeks. His return to the field to start Week 1 prep puts him on the proper trajectory to suit up Sunday against the Patriots. However, his status for the matchup likely won't be more definitive until the team releases its initial injury report later in the week.
